| | Recommended Setting | Why | |---|---|---| | Backend | OpenGL (or Vulkan for newer devices) | OpenGL offers about 10% better performance on most Android devices; Vulkan may work better on flagship phones | | Rendering Mode | Buffered Rendering | Required for most PSP games; don't use "Non Buffered" as it breaks many visual effects | | Hardware Transform | ✅ Enabled | Massive speed boost – essential for fighting games | | Vertex Cache | ✅ Enabled | Improves rendering efficiency | | Software Skinning | ✅ Enabled | Helps with character model rendering | | Lazy Texture Caching | ✅ Enabled | Speeds up texture loading; improves performance | | Disable Slower Effects | ✅ Enabled | Eliminates lag-inducing visual effects | | Texture Filtering | Linear | Better visual quality with minimal performance impact | | Spline/Bezier Quality | Low | Reduces processing overhead for curves | | Rendering Resolution | 1x PSP (or 2x on powerful devices) | 1x is safest for performance; 2x enhances visuals on Snapdragon 800+ devices | | Upscale Level | Auto | Balances visual quality with performance | | Lower Resolution for Effects | Aggressive | Frees up GPU resources |
